The former India cricket player Yuvraj Singh welcomed the 20 -year cricket career of Piyush Chawla, after his retirement announcement, highlighting his ability to perform under pressure. Chawla, who represented India in three tests, 25 ODI and seven T20i taking 43 counters, was one of the victorious campaigns of the Victorious T20 World Cup in India and 2011 of the ODI World Cup.Chawla concluded her professional cricket career with impressive statistics, including 192 windows in an equal number of IPL matches. His last IPL passage was with the Mumbai Indians from 2022 to 2024.“Over the years, I have played alongside many teammates, but few showed the resilience and the dedication that #piyushchawla brought to the park.
